To enter and work in China you will need to obtain a Z visa prior to your departure. Tourist and business visit visas do not entitle you to work in China.

For how long is a Z visa valid for?
A Z visa allows you to stay in the country for 30 days from the date of arrival. During this time your employer/ school will seek a temporary residence permit for the duration of your contract.
What will I need to apply for a Z visa?
- Passport (valid for a minimum of 18 months from the date submitting your application and with a sufficient number of blank pages)
- Completed visa application (see links below)
- Passport photo
- Work permit (provided by the school/employer)
- Invitation letter/ contract
- Medical Check
The Chinese Embassy and Consulates General in Australia do not accept visa applications. You will need to submit your application to the Chinese Visa Application Service Centre (CVASC)
You can apply in person or by mail to a CVASC near you.
